In the ever-evolving world of mobile photography, quick and convenient tools are essential. Snapseed, developed by Google, is a popular photo editing app that offers professional-level editing tools for your photos. One of the lesser-known but highly useful features in mobile photography and editing is the use of QR codes to store and share photo editing settings.
In this article, we will explore photo editing QR codes in Snapseed—what they are, how they work, and why you should consider using them for your creative projects.
A photo editing QR code in Snapseed is a scannable barcode that stores the editing settings or filters you apply to a photo. Once you create a unique combination of filters and adjustments in Snapseed, you can generate a QR code that others can scan to apply the same settings to their photos. This feature is highly beneficial for photographers and social media content creators who want to share their editing styles without having to manually explain each setting.

1. What is Snapseed’s QR Look feature?Snapseed’s QR Look feature allows users to create QR codes from the photo editing settings they applied to a photo. These QR codes can be scanned to replicate the same settings on other photos, allowing easy sharing and consistent results.
2. How do I scan a QR code for photo editing in Snapseed?Open Snapseed, load a photo, tap on the “Menu” icon (three dots), and select “Scan QR Look.” Then, use your phone’s camera to scan the QR code. The photo will automatically be edited using the settings stored in the QR code.
3. Can I modify the settings after scanning a QR code in Snapseed?Yes, you can adjust the settings after scanning a QR code. Simply navigate to the edit stack, where you can tweak individual settings like brightness, contrast, and filters.
4. Can I use the QR Look feature on any device?Snapseed’s QR Look feature works on both Android and iOS devices. Just ensure you have the latest version of the Snapseed app installed on your phone.
5. How can I share my Snapseed QR code with others?Once you generate a QR code, you can share it via social media, messaging apps, or email. Snapseed allows you to export the QR code as an image, which can be easily shared.
6. Do I need an internet connection to scan a QR code in Snapseed?No, you do not need an internet connection to scan or apply QR codes in Snapseed. The process is done entirely within the app.
